You are on page 1of 3

‫خطـوات تصـميم النظـام‬

‫الخطوة األولى ‪ :‬تصميم الهيكل العام للنظام ‪ :Genera System Structure‬تُوجد ثالثة مداخل عامة لوضع الهيكل‬
‫العام لنظام المعلومات وهي ‪:‬المدخل المركزي ‪،‬المدخل الالمركزي ‪ ،‬المدخل الموزع ‪.‬‬

‫عادة ما يُوجد تعارض في الوحدات االقتصادية بين فلسفة اإلدارة وبين احتياجات المستخدمين فيما يتعلق بتحديد القدر‬
‫المالئم من المركزية أو الالمركزية في التشغيل ‪ ،‬ولقد اتجهت معظم المنظمات في بداية األمر نحو المركزية في التشغيل‬
‫‪.‬‬

‫ا ًلخطوة الثانية ‪ :‬االختيار بين بدائل التصميم ‪ :Design Alternatives‬هناك العديد من المداخل المتبعة عند تصميم‬
‫النظام منها ما يتفق مع فلسفة المركزية في التشغيل ومنها ما يتفق مع فلسفة الالمركزية في التشغيل ‪ ،‬ويعتمد اختيار‬
‫المدخل المعين على حجم ودرجة تعقيد النظام ‪ ،‬ومن هذه المداخل المستخدمة في تصميم النظم ما يلي ‪ :‬التصميم من أعلى‬
‫إلى أسفل ‪ Top-Down Design‬التصميم من أسفل إلى أعلى ‪ ، Bottom-Up Design‬التصميم بالتجزئة ثم‬
‫التجميع ‪. Integrate-Later Design‬‬

‫الخطوة الثالثة ‪ :‬تحضير مواصفات النظام ‪ :Preparation of Design Specifications‬وهي تحديد مواصفات‬
‫عناصر نظام المعلومات من مدخالت البيانات ‪ ،‬تشغيل البيانات ‪ ،‬قاعدة البيانات ‪ ،‬مخرجات النظام ‪ ،‬وإجراءات الرقابة‬
‫واألمن ‪ .‬ويتطلب هذا تحديد تتابع التصميم ثم تحديد محتويات المواصفات ‪:‬‬

‫الخطوة الرابعة‪ :‬اختيار األجهزة ‪ :Configuration Selection‬يجب تحديد التطبيقات التي سيتم تشغيلها ‪ ،‬ثم اختيار‬
‫أجهزة الحاسب اآللي التي تتناسب مع هذه التطبيقات وليس العكس ‪.‬‬

‫الًخطوة الخامسة‪ :‬اختيار وتدريب األفراد‪ :Selection and Training of Personnel‬ويتم فيها األتي ‪:‬‬

‫‪ .1‬تبدأ هذه الخطوة عند نهاية مرحلة التصميم وفي بداية مرحلة التنفيذ وهي تشمل اختيار وتدريب األفراد الذين‬
‫سيقومون بتشغيل النظام ‪ ،‬وكذلك تدريب األفراد واألقسام األخرى التي ستتعامل مع النظام ‪.‬‬

‫يقوم المتخصص في فريق تصميم النظام بتحديد المؤهالت والخبرات المطلوبة في المتعاملين مع النظام ‪.‬‬ ‫‪.2‬‬

‫يتولى قسم األفراد مسئولية االختيار والتدريب مع إمكانية االستعانة بخبراء خارجيين للمساعدة في اختيار األفراد ‪.‬‬ ‫‪.3‬‬

‫يمكن أن يكون هؤالء األفراد من العاملين الحاليين في الشركة أو تعيين جدد ‪.‬‬ ‫‪.4‬‬
‫ضرورة االهتمام بمدير نظام المعلومات الذي يُشرف على عملية التنفيذ والتشغيل ‪.‬‬ ‫‪.5‬‬

‫‪ .6‬تُقدم شركات الحاسب اآللي برامج تدريبية لألفراد الذين سيقومون بتشغيل النظام ‪ ،‬وتُغطي هذه البرامج كل التفاصيل‬
‫عن مكونات األجهزة وكيفية تشغيلها وصيانتها ‪.‬‬

‫‪ .7‬عادة ما تشتمل برامج التدريب على ما يلي ‪ :‬اإلجراءات الجديدة للتشغيل والرقابة ‪ ،‬جداول دقيقة بمواقيت إدخال‬
‫البيانات ‪ ،‬التغيرات في ترتيب البيانات ‪ ،‬التقارير ‪ ،‬الملفات ‪ ،‬كيفية إضافة وحذف البيانات ‪ ،‬كيفية استخدام مخرجات‬
‫النظام ‪.‬‬

‫الخطوة السادسة‪ :‬تقرير تصميم النظم‪ :‬بعد اكتمال مرحلة تصميم النظام يقدم مصمم النظام تقريرا ً شامالً ‪ ،‬وبموافقة‬
‫اإلدارة العليا للمنظمة على هذا التقرير تبدأ عملية التنفيذ الفعلي للنظام ‪.‬‬

‫تطـبيق النظـام ‪System Implementation‬‬

‫تبدأ مرحلة التنفيذ الفعلي بوضع خطة تفصيلية لخطوات التنفيذ تشتمل على األتي ‪:‬‬

‫التواريخ المخططة لبداية ونهاية كل خطوة ‪.‬‬ ‫‪.1‬‬

‫إجراءات تنفيذ كل خطوة من خطوات التنفيذ ‪.‬‬ ‫‪.2‬‬

‫تخصيص المسئوليات على األفراد المشتركين في مرحلة التنفيذ ‪.‬‬ ‫‪.3‬‬

‫الميزانية الرأسمالية المخصصة للتنفيذ ‪.‬‬ ‫‪.4‬‬

‫بعد أخذ موافقة اإلدارة العليا للشركة على خطة التنفيذ تبدأ الخطوات الفعلية لتنفيذ هذه الخطة ‪.‬‬

‫خطوات تنفيذ النظام ‪:‬‬

‫‪ .1‬شراء األجهزة ‪Purchase of Hardware‬‬


‫‪Programming‬‬ ‫‪ .2‬تجهيز المكان وتركيب األجهزة ‪ .Physical Preparation 3‬تحضير البرامج‬

‫‪ .4‬اختبار البرامج ‪Program Testing‬‬

‫‪ .5‬اختبار النظام ‪System Testing‬‬

‫‪ .6‬التحول إلى النظام الجديد ‪. Conversion‬‬

‫سابعا ً ‪ :‬التوثيق النهائي للنظام‪ Final System Documentation‬ضرورة تزامن عملية توثيق النظام مع كل خطوة‬
‫في كل مرحلة من مراحل دورة حياة النظام ‪.‬‬

‫تقــييم ما بعـد التنفـيذ ‪Post-Implementation Evaluation‬‬

‫يتم هذا التقييم بعد تنفيذ وتشغيل نظام المعلومات الجديد لفترة من الزمن تكفي إلتمام دورة تشغيل كاملة في النظام‪.‬‬

‫صـيانة النظــام ‪System Maintenance‬‬

‫من العادة تتم صيانة النظام على النحو التالي ‪:‬‬

‫‪ .1‬يُمكن إطالة عمر النظام الجديد من خالل برامج الصيانة المستمرة للنظام ليكون متالئما ً مع البيئة التي يعمل فيها‬
‫والتي تتصف بالتغيرات الشديدة على فترات قصيرة نسبيا ً‪.‬‬

‫يُقصد بعملية الصيانة حذف أو إضافة أو تعديل أو تحسين في عنصر من عناصر النظام أو أحد مكوناته ‪.‬‬ ‫‪.2‬‬

‫يجب تحديث البرامج من وقت إلى آخر لتلبي احتياجات المستخدمين من النظام ‪.‬‬ ‫‪.3‬‬

‫ضرورة توثيق النظام إلجراء التعديالت المستمرة على النظا‬ ‫‪.4‬‬

You might also like